Decoding the Massey Ferguson 135 Wiring Diagram
At its core, a Massey Ferguson 135 wiring diagram is a schematic representation of the tractor's electrical system. It visually illustrates how different components are connected and how electricity flows between them. These diagrams are invaluable tools for diagnosing problems, as they allow you to trace circuits and identify faulty connections or components. Imagine trying to fix a complex puzzle without a picture of the finished product – that’s what working on a tractor's electrical system without a wiring diagram can feel like.
The diagrams typically use standardized symbols to represent various electrical parts. For example, a circle with an "X" might represent a light bulb, while a series of lines could denote a switch. Understanding these symbols is key to interpreting the diagram accurately. A Massey Ferguson 135 wiring diagram will break down the electrical system into logical sections, making it easier to focus on specific areas. These sections often include:
- Lighting circuits (headlights, taillights, indicators)
- Ignition system
- Starting system
- Charging system (alternator/generator and battery)
- Instrumentation (gauges and warning lights)

For instance, when dealing with a dead battery, the diagram will show the path from the alternator to the battery, allowing you to check the connections, voltage regulator, and wiring for any breaks or shorts. Similarly, if your lights aren't working, the diagram will trace the circuit from the switch through the fuse (if applicable) to the bulbs.
When you encounter a problem, the Massey Ferguson 135 wiring diagram provides a systematic approach to troubleshooting. You can follow these steps:
- Identify the specific problem (e.g., no crank, dim lights).
- Locate the relevant section of the wiring diagram.
- Trace the circuit involved, checking each component and connection point.
- Use a multimeter to test voltage and continuity at various points along the circuit.
